Brentford v Preston preview

Team news ahead of Saturday's League One clash between Brentford and Preston North End at Griffin Park.

Bradley Wright-Phillips and Sam Saunders could return to the starting line-up for the Bees.

Striker Wright-Phillips and winger Saunders climbed off the bench Brentford trailing to Swindon on Tuesday night, and their introduction helped Uwe Rosler's side fight back to win 2-1.

The Bees have no new injury worries following their midweek victory and have club captain Kevin O'Connor and striker Farid El Alagui edging closer to fitness after lengthy spells out.

Long-serving midfielder O'Connor has been out for four months with an ankle problem while El Alagui suffered a knee injury in October.

The duo will not feature on Saturday but have been pencilled in for a reserve game against Charlton early next week.

North End hope to have Jack King back in contention for the trip.

The versatile midfielder missed Tuesday night's 1-0 win at Notts County due to a hip problem picked up during last weekend's Deepdale triumph over Stevenage.

Defender Bailey Wright came off at half-time at Meadow Lane and faces a late fitness test after aggravating the ankle injury he first sustained against MK Dons a fortnight ago.

Midfielder Joel Byrom is closing in on a return following hernia surgery but remains around a week away from action.

Long-term injury victim Scott Laird (broken leg) is set to resume non-contact training in the near future.

North End are unbeaten in their last five league matches, claiming three wins and two draws.
